The application for the ABSA BMI Bursary for the academic year 2022 is now open for all Grade 12 students in South Africa.

Scholar

Each year we select a handful of talented top performers and provide with financial support enabling them to complete their education and potentially pursuing a career with us on qualifying.

The ABSA BMI (Business Mathematics and Informatics) bursary is a bursary for students who have enrolled for one of the four qualifications provided by BMI, namely:

  • Actuarial Sciences
  • Quantitative Risk Management
  • Business Analytics/Data Science
  • Financial Mathematics

This programme covers Tuition, Registration, Accommodation, Laptop  & Text Books.

ABSA BMI BURSARY APPLICATION ELIGIBILITY

Minimum requirements:

  • The candidate must be a South African Citizen with bar coded ID
  • A minimum of 70% in Mathematics and English  in Grade 11.

Supporting documents required:

  • Motivational letter, where motivation is given on why the bursary should be awarded to the candidate (no longer than 1 page)
  • Grade 11 results (and most recent Matric results if available), and
  • The candidate must have applied for and admitted into the BMI programme at NWU (or intending to apply).

HOW TO APPLY FOR ABSA BMI BURSARY

To apply for the ABSA BMI bursary, please complete the online application form. You will have the opportunity to upload your documents and other relevant documentation as part of this process.
